// Notes for the weekly eng sync re: Gallerywhisper, our museum audio-guide app.
// This constant sets the prefetch radius for exhibit audio clips. At the
// Hollen Pavilion pilot we learned visitors walk faster than our original
// estimate, so clips were buffering mid-stride. Bumping this to three rooms
// ahead fixed it, at a modest bandwidth cost. Don't lower it without testing
// on the slow gallery wifi first — seriously, it's painful. The trace token
// from the pilot build that validated this number is appended just below.

trace token, kahap-bagaf: htk4_8458

Hey Marla — handing off the Cartwheel driver-assignment rollout before the eng sync. Heuristic v9 is staged, pickup-latency metrics look fine, and the fallback flag is documented in the runbook. Only thing left is promoting the signed bundle to prod, which needs the deploy key below.

signing key of hahag-tahag = bky4_v18e

Subject: Seed samples for the Marlow Vale trial plot

Hi dispatch team — quick one before the morning run. The seed samples for the Greengate Agronomy trial plot are in the small insulated tote by my desk, clearly tagged by variety. They need to stay cool and dry, so please keep them out of the van's sun side and don't let them sit on the dock. The field coordinator at Marlow Vale is expecting them before lunch. When the Ashford Courier driver arrives, pass on the hand-over instruction written immediately below.

handover note for hafop-yageg: the soriel tamys courier leaves the tamdor quenok aldvan ledger at gate 5357 under passcode 293424